NOBODY'S GIRL (2026)

'NOBODY’S GIRL is a self-portrait photography project that uses the artist’s own body as a site of tension between visibility and refusal. Positioned between fantasy and lived reality, the work examines how bodies, particularly those read through gendered expectations, are looked at, claimed, and interpreted.

Rather than presenting a fixed identity, the work exists in a space of negotiation; where gender is not something revealed, but something imposed through looking. Glamour, theatrical lighting and spectacle echo environments where bodies are consumed, yet the subject rejects external ownership and the demand to be legible.

By turning the camera inward, the project reclaims self-portraiture as an act of agency. One that allows for desire, denial, poise and fatigue to coexist in contradiction.

Simultaneously a declaration and an interruption, NOBODY’S GIRL does not seek to explain gender, but to remain inside its pressures: the performance, the scrutiny, and the cost of being seen.’
